What types of entry-level jobs can I apply for if I have no computer skills?

If you have no computer skills, there are still many entry-level roles available, such as warehouse associate, retail sales associate, delivery driver, janitorial staff, or food service worker. These positions generally emphasize manual labor, customer service, or basic operational tasks that do not require technology use. Many employers provide on-the-job training for required duties, and some may offer opportunities to gradually develop basic computer skills over time. Being reliable, punctual, and having good communication skills are highly valued in these roles.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in a role that requires no computer skills, and why are they important?

To thrive in roles that require no computer skills, such as manual labor or entry-level service positions, you typically need physical stamina, attention to detail, and basic literacy or numeracy. These positions may use simple tools or equipment, but do not require digital or technical system proficiency. Reliability, good communication, and a strong work ethic are soft skills that help individuals excel in these roles. These qualities are essential for maintaining productivity, ensuring safety, and contributing positively to team environments where technology use is minimal or absent.

What jobs can I do without computer skills?

Jobs that typically do not require computer skills include roles such as retail cashier, warehouse worker, cleaning staff, construction laborer, and food service worker. These positions often focus on manual tasks and interpersonal skills, with minimal or no use of computers. Basic communication and physical stamina are usually sufficient for these roles.

Position Summary
Provides basic level of workstation support to an assigned customer base which includes installing and troubleshooting workstation and peripheral hardware and software; customer training; workstation security administration; and documentation. This is a customer-oriented position and provides direct support for all desktop and endpoint related issues submitted by the enterprise.
